Frequently Asked Questions About Cash Home Sales

Is it legal to sell my house during divorce?

Generally, yes, but both parties must usually agree to the sale if the property is considered marital or community property. If one party refuses to sell, the other may need a court order to proceed with the sale.

Who’s getting the proceeds from the home sale in a divorce?

The distribution of proceeds from the sale of a home during a divorce typically depends on the property division laws in the relevant jurisdiction and any pre-existing marital agreements (like prenups). In community property states, assets and debts acquired during the marriage are usually divided equally. In equitable distribution states, assets are divided based on what is deemed fair, which might not always be a 50/50 split.

Is it better to sell my house before or after the divorce?

The decision to sell before or after divorce depends on various factors including financial implications, tax considerations, emotional readiness, and the housing market. Selling before might simplify property division, but selling after might provide more time to prepare the home and possibly obtain a better price..

How long do you have to sell a house after divorce?

There isn’t a universal time frame. The decision could be stipulated in the divorce decree or based on an agreement between both parties. If the court orders the sale, the order will likely specify a timeline. If there’s no order or agreement, either party can typically initiate a sale, but the other party’s consent might be required.

Do I have to pay taxes if I sell my house after divorce?

In the U.S., individuals can often exclude up to $250,000 (or $500,000 for married couples filing jointly) of gain from the sale of their primary residence if they’ve lived in it for at least two of the last five years. However, after a divorce, if only one ex-spouse remains the owner and lives in the house, only the individual’s exclusion (typically $250,000) can be claimed.
